Transaction 23e54e20a028109fe142c85288af9604940b501f62b7ce9185cf13dde51a01ce
1 Input
1 Output
-
23e54e20a028109fe142c85288af9604940b501f62b7ce9185cf13dde51a01ce:0
- value
- 379184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 028ab6dec771a52aaf17ea0cada94c5752a85656 OP_EQUAL
- address
- 31vTSy8JVbhzurd3BiiE514ADS3qwtkeFt